Ethylene synthesis is promoted positive feedback promotion, or autocatalytic by c 2 h 4 in reproductive climacteric tissue. However, in nonclimacteric tissues, the rate of ethylene synthesis remains constantly low throughout ripening and senescence.

In climacteric fruits such as tomato, banana, and apple, ripening is accompanied by a peak in respiration measured by an increase in co 2 or o 2 consumption and a burst in ethylene production.

The climacteric is a stage of fruit ripening associated with increased ethylene production and a rise in cellular respiration.
